Get PriceSHORT CIRCUIT GEN. LOAD Accidental Connection GEN. Creates Fault LOAD System voltage and load resistance determine the flow of current. During a short circuit, only the resistance of the fault path limits current. Current may increase to many times the load current. Get PriceThe large induction motors are widely used in plants such as cement factories, steel mill, pumping stations, petrochemical plant and power plant, as ventilators, pumps, blowers etc. During the short circuit (SC), the induction motor is converted into an induction generator [1] and contributes to short-circuit current (SCC) [2]

Get PriceIEC 60909 describes methods for the hand calculation of short-circuit currents that lead to results that are generally of acceptable accuracy for their intended purpose. However, other methods are not excluded provided they give results of at least the same precision.
